Jammu and Kashmir interlocutor: 13 delegations meet him on day 1st | KNO

The Central government appointed interlocutor Dineshwar Sharma Monday reached Srinagar on his four day visit. During the visit, Sharma, the former IB Chief, will be meeting around 60 delegations. Sources told KNS, that on the first day around 13 delegations, which were all non-political, met him and put forth their views. It may be mentioned that Hurriyat Conference, considered a key stakeholder, has refused to be part of the dialogue process citing it a “futile exercise”. Main Opposition National Conference (NC) president Farooq Abdullah has termed Sharma’s appointment as waste of time. Sharma was accorded ‘Z’ category armed security cover which means he would be secured by commandos of the Central Reserve Police Force (CRPF) whenever he travels to any part of the country. The CRPF has a special unit that provides armed VIP security to about 70 dignitaries at present. Sharma, an old Kashmir hand in the country’s internal intelligence agency, enjoys the rank and status of a cabinet secretary. Union Home minister Rajnath Singh had said that Sharma would decide whom to engage with for a resolution of the Kashmir issue.
